Salford City Council is seeking an experienced programme or project professional to lead a portfolio of infrastructure projects and programmes that support the city’s growth ambitions.
You will work with technical teams, consultants and partners to ensure successful delivery from concept through to delivery.
The role requires significant infrastructure/ regeneration experience, strong commercial awareness, and proven ability to manage budgets and contracts within complex programmes.
